I've been trying to set up my existing UPS Shipping account within QB Enterprise Desktop. I've entered all the fields according to the instructions and invoice, but when I click "next" I receive the following error:
"Account Registration Failed"
"Missing or invalid password [9670011]"
There was no prompt to enter a password within the set up manager.
UPS and QB help desk were not helpful in resolving this error. Can anyone assist?
The error occurs because UPS no longer supports the Shipping Manager software in QuickBooks, ACMN. We're currently in the process of switching providers, and I'll elaborate on the specifics below.
Establishing new connections to UPS accounts is unattainable since QuickBooks Desktop Enterprise no longer has a direct integration with UPS Shipping Manager. If you haven't set up shipping with your carrier, you won’t be able to do so until we launch our new Shipping Manager experience in May. With this, there will be a new notification in QuickBooks regarding this upcoming experience.
For more details about the new and improved shipping experience, refer to this article: Get ready for a new shipping experience in QuickBooks Desktop.
In the meantime, I suggest generating shipping labels directly through the UPS website.
